COVID-19 3rd Dose Vaccine Available
Based on CDC recommendations, third vaccine doses are available now for people who are considered moderately or severely immunosuppressed. These would include those who:
- Receive active cancer treatment for tumors or cancers of the blood.
- Received an organ transplant and are taking medicine to suppress the immune system.
- Have either had a stem cell transplant within the last two years or are taking medicine to suppress the immune system.
- Were diagnosed with DiGeorge syndrome or Wiskott-Aldrich syndrome.
- Are diagnosed with HIV and have a high viral load or low CD4 count, or are not currently taking medication to treat HIV.
- Are taking drugs such as high-dose steroids or other medications that may cause severe suppression of the immune system.
If you are not sure whether you fit into any of these categories, please contact your medical provider.

The Sumner County Health Department has announced that Friday, June 25th will be the last day of COVID-19 vaccine administration at the Volunteer State Community College campus. Vaccines will be available at the Portland, Hendersonville, and Gallatin Clinics starting Monday, June 28th from 8:30 AM – 4:00 PM Monday through Friday.
